These are text editors with additional functionalities to … WebNov 5, 2015 · 2 Answers Sorted by: 8 On Linux, you can use the program time to get the execution time. Just prepend it to your Perl script like this. $ cat foo.pl 1 while 1; $ time perl foo.pl ^C real 0m1.006s user 0m0.756s sys 0m0.008s Of course this is not limited to Perl programs. WebA regular expression is a string of characters that defines the pattern or patterns you are viewing. The syntax of regular expressions in Perl is very similar to what you will find within other regular expression.supporting programs, such as sed, grep, and awk. WebSep 26, 2024 · They are small Perl programs that are run directly from command line. Like this one from the Kubernetes job documentation: perl -Mbignum=bpi -wle "print bpi (2000)" perl is the Perl language interpreter. -M and -wle are command line switches (or options) that modify the perl 's behaviour. See below for explanation of what they mean.
